Prep and Cook Time

  • Preparation: 10 minutes
  • Cooking/blending: 5 minutes
  • Total Time: 15 minutes

Yield

  • Serves 2 generous portions

Difficulty Level

  • Easy – Ideal for beginners‍ and smoothie ⁢enthusiasts ⁤alike

Ingredients

  • 1½ ⁣cups frozen mixed​ berries ⁣ (blueberries, strawberries, raspberries)
  • 1‍ medium frozen‍ banana, peeled and chopped
  • ½ cup full-fat coconut milk (for creaminess)
  • ¼ cup plain⁢ Greek yogurt ⁢(adds protein and tang)
  • 1 tbsp chia ​seeds (for⁣ thickness and nutrition)
  • 1 tbsp almond butter (optional: creamy ‌richness)
  • 1 tsp ‌raw honey or⁤ maple syrup (adjust ⁤sweetness)
  • 1 tbsp ground flaxseed ⁢(optional superfood boost)
  • 1‍ tbsp cacao ⁤nibs (for ‍texture and antioxidants)
  • Ice cubes (only if needed for extra ​thickness)

Instructions

  1. Combine⁢ the frozen⁤ berries and‍ banana in a high-speed blender. Using frozen⁢ fruits is critical to⁣ achieve that thick and creamy consistency without watering down‌ the ⁣bowl.
  2. Add the‍ coconut ​milk and ​Greek yogurt.These ingredients provide the foundation for a​ silky texture, balancing creaminess with a slight tanginess. Start pouring coconut milk ⁤slowly ⁤to ‌control thickness.
  3. Incorporate⁤ chia seeds and almond⁤ butter. Both act as natural ​thickeners ⁤while enhancing the ​nutrient ⁤profile. ‍Let chia seeds ⁢soak ​slightly​ by⁤ blending on low speed for 10 seconds,then​ pause.
  4. Sweeten with honey‍ or maple syrup. ​Taste as ⁣you ​blend and adjust ​to find your perfect‍ balance between sweetness ⁤and⁣ the natural tartness of the berries.
  5. Blend the ⁢mixture on high until it reaches a velvety, spoonable ‌texture. If ‍the ‍blend is⁤ too thin, add​ a ​few ice cubes⁤ or ⁣extra ⁤frozen ⁢banana chunks-do this sparingly to avoid diluting flavors.
  6. Stop blending and ⁤scrape down ​the‍ sides ‌to ⁤ensure every ingredient is fully‌ incorporated. The ideal consistency should be thick enough ⁢to hold the weight of your toppings without sinking.
  7. Pour into bowls ⁢and promptly garnish with cacao nibs, fresh‍ fruit ⁤slices, toasted ⁢coconut flakes, or granola for​ an enticing ‍contrast of⁤ textures.

Tips for Success

  • Frozen Fruits: Always ⁣use high-quality ‍frozen fruit without ​added sugars⁤ or syrups. ​Fresh fruit can be used but⁤ will lead to a ‌thinner texture.
  • Creaminess‌ Drivers: ⁣ Incorporate ​full-fat⁣ coconut milk or avocado for‍ richness. Greek yogurt complements with ⁣protein and ‌a subtle tang.
  • Texture Tricks: Chia and flaxseeds are natural ‍thickeners; soak them briefly for enhanced ⁢smoothness.
  • Balancing‍ Flavors: Tart berries contrasted with ⁢a​ hint of honey or maple syrup create a tasty flavor profile without excess sugar.
  • Blending Technique: Pulse frist, then blend at‍ high speed.Over-blending can warm the fruit and⁤ thin ⁢the smoothie.

Serving⁣ Suggestions

Serve your thick⁣ and creamy creation in ⁣wide, shallow bowls to ‌showcase‌ the vibrant colors and luscious‍ textures. Top with fresh berries, a sprinkle of superfood seeds ‌like hemp or pumpkin, and a drizzle of⁤ nut butter to elevate both taste and presentation. For a tropical twist, ‍add toasted coconut flakes and diced ​kiwi for ‍a ‍refreshing burst. ⁢Pair with⁣ a light green tea or a chilled glass ⁤of coconut water for a‌ complete, nourishing‌ breakfast or snack⁤ experience.

Q1: what⁣ exactly​ is a‍ smoothie bowl, ​and ‌how does it​ differ from a regular smoothie?
A: A smoothie bowl is essentially a thicker, spoonable ​version ⁤of your favourite smoothie, served in a bowl and topped with ⁢an‍ array of vibrant, nutritious ingredients. Unlike a⁢ drinkable smoothie, smoothie bowls have a creamy, ⁤dense texture that lets you ⁣decorate ‌and enjoy every bite.⁢ It’s like the ​artistic sibling ​of ⁢the smoothie ‍family-equally delicious but ‍more visually‍ exciting!

Q2: why is the “blend thick ‌& creamy” aspect so important when making the⁢ perfect‌ smoothie‌ bowl?
A: The texture ‍is the ⁢heart and soul of a smoothie bowl. Blending thick and creamy ensures ‍the bowl holds its shape and supports those colorful toppings without ​becoming a ‍soggy mess.⁢ Achieving that⁤ luscious, velvety consistency transforms your⁤ breakfast‌ or snack into a satisfying,⁢ indulgent experience that’s‍ as enjoyable to eat as it is ⁣to look⁣ at.

Q3: What ingredients help​ achieve that ideal thick and creamy texture?
A: Frozen ‌fruits like bananas, mangoes, or berries are your best‍ friends ⁢for thickness-they add⁢ natural sweetness⁤ and a frosty creaminess. Greek ​yogurt or ⁢plant-based alternatives boost ⁤the cream factor while providing protein. ⁣Nut butters and​ avocado bring smooth richness. A splash of liquid (like almond ​milk or ​coconut⁢ water)⁤ should ⁤be minimal-just enough to ⁣blend,⁢ not to⁤ thin out the mixture.

Q4: How do I avoid a ‍smoothie bowl that’s too runny or ⁢too dense?
A: Start by adding your frozen fruits and creamy bases, ⁢then blend gradually. Use just a splash of liquid at first, pausing to ​test​ the thickness. If it’s too thick to blend, add another⁢ tiny burst of liquid. if​ it’s ⁤too runny, ⁣toss in a⁣ bit more frozen fruit or ⁤a scoop of oats. Finding the perfect balance is a ​joyful‍ experiment, but remember-the ​bowl should be thick enough ⁤to scoop ⁤with a ‍spoon, not sip through a straw.

Q6: Are there any blender ​tricks or tools that help ⁤perfect ⁤the creamy blend?
A: High-powered ⁤blenders⁢ are fantastic, but‍ even standard blenders can deliver great‌ results with the right⁤ technique. Pulse to break⁣ down ⁣frozen‍ chunks, then blend on‌ medium speed⁣ to keep things creamy without overheating. Using a⁤ tamper tool or stopping the⁢ blender to scrape down⁢ the sides helps ensure an even texture.⁢ And⁢ always freeze​ your‍ fruit ​chunks well-they blend smoother and keep your ‌bowl cold and refreshing.
